Position Summary
The Senior Manager Modernization will lead Integration Engineering Platform modernizations by transforming legacy applications into scalable, cloud-native solutions using AI-assisted, automation-first approaches. The role drives end-to-end initiatives including certificate management, refactoring, re-platforming, and microservices decomposition, leveraging GenAI for code analysis, dependency mapping, and accelerated migration. It ensures modernization improves scalability, resilience, performance, and cost efficiency while aligning with enterprise standards. The function embeds automation and AI across the SDLC to enhance speed, quality, and reduce technical debt. It also advances AIOps, observability, and operational stability, delivering resilient systems and measurable business value through sustained modernization outcomes.

Required Qualifications
- 7+ years of software engineering experience, with people and delivery leadership
- 5+ years leading large‑scale modernization or platform transformation programs.
- Strong experience modernizing legacy systems using cloud, automation, and AI‑assisted techniques
- Solid understanding of microservices, event‑driven systems, API design, and integration patterns
- Hands‑on experience with Azure, AWS, or GCP, and platforms such as Kafka, API Management, containers, and CI/CD pipelines
- Experience applying automation and AI across development, testing, and operations
- Proven ability to lead teams in Agile and DevOps environments
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ience using GenAI/LLMs for code analysis, refactoring, documentation, or test generation
- Background in healthcare, PBM, or other regulated enterprise environments
- Experience modernizing middleware platforms such as IBM ACE, MQ, DataPower, or API Integrated systems
- Exposure to AIOps, intelligent monitoring, and automated incident management
- Experience managing globally distributed engineering teams

Pay Range
The typical pay range for this role is:
$118,450.00 - $260,590.00
This pay range represents the base hourly rate or base annual full-time salary for all positions in the job grade within which this position falls. The actual base salary offer will depend on a variety of factors including experience, education, geography and other relevant factors. This position is eligible for a CVS Health bonus, commission or short-term incentive program in addition to the base pay range listed above. This position also includes an award target in the company’s equity award program.
